- 博客(8)
- 资源 (2)
- 收藏
- 关注
转载 Java 通过Socket监听指定服务器(IP)的指定端口,及向指定服务器的指定端口发送信息
客户端:向指定端口发送信息package com.jszc.lottery.modules.longpay.util;import java.io.BufferedReader;import java.io.IOException;import java.io.InputStreamReader;import java.io.PrintWriter;import java.net.Socke
2017-11-30 13:58:03 28715 7
原创 将String字符串转换为GB2312编码
StringBuilder sb = new StringBuilder();sb.append("balalabala巴啦啦小魔仙01");String utf8 = new String(sb.toString().getBytes("UTF-8"));String unicode = new String(utf8.getBytes(), "UTF-8");String gbk = n
2017-11-30 13:45:54 10572
转载 Java时间和时间戳的相互转换
时间转换为时间戳: /* * 将时间转换为时间戳 */ public static String dateToStamp(String s) throws ParseException{ String res; SimpleDateFormat simpleDateFormat = new SimpleDateFormat("y
2017-11-29 15:40:34 1480
转载 java使double/float保留两位小数的多方法 java保留两位小数
import java.text.DecimalFormat; DecimalFormat df = new DecimalFormat("######0.00"); double d1 = 3.23456 double d2 = 0.0;double d3 = 2.0;df.format(d1); df.format(d2); df.format(d3); 3个结果分
2017-11-29 15:39:04 4131
转载 Redis在windows上的可视化应用
Redis是一个key-value存储系统。和Memcached类似,它支持存储的value类型相对更多,包括string(字符串)、list(链表)、set(集合)、zset(sorted set –有序集合)和hash(哈希类型)。这些数据类型都支持push/pop、add/remove及取交集并集和差集及更丰富的操作,而且这些操作都是原子性的。在此基础上,redis支持各种不同方式的排序。与m
2017-11-27 16:58:28 606
原创 实现Runnable接口,通过Thread启动多线程
package com.xiner.demo;public class Demo implements Runnable{ boolean flag = false; public void run(){ for(int i=0;i<10;i++){ System.out.println("-----"+i); } }
2017-11-22 10:08:03 544
原创 List<T>泛型集合根据对象的某一属性排序
Object t;List<MemberByKeyWord> list2 = new ArrayList<MemberByKeyWord>();Object[] objs = list2.toArray(); for(int i=0;i<list2.size();i++){ for(int j=i+1;j<l
2017-11-17 15:39:50 1512
原创 Connection is read-only. Queries leading to data modification are not allowed
造成此异常的原因是权限不足,大多情况下是因为业务层(Service)造成的。 这时候需要在业务层加上: @Transactional(readOnly = false)如下图所示: @Transactional提供一种控制事务管理的快捷手段,具体用法还请自行百度,因为我也并不会啊。。。。。。。。 这里附上在别处看的一篇对于此注解的解释:http://blog.csdn.net/bluehea
2017-11-14 14:57:42 460
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人